contents <p>Monte Carlo simulation have been performed in order to study the preferential Co2+ solvation in water-ammonia mixture. The simulation was done for a system consisting one Co2+ in 4.76%, 10%, 18.6 % and 30% aqueous ammonia solution at temperature of 293.16 K, using ab initio three-body potentials for Co&ndash
